다음을 통해 공유


BIGINT 형식

적용 대상: 예(예)로 표시된 확인 Databricks SQL 예(예)로 표시된 확인 Databricks 런타임

8바이트 부호 있는 정수를 나타냅니다.

구문

{ BIGINT |
  LONG }

제한

숫자 범위는 -9,223,372,036,854,775,808에서 9,223,372,036,854,775,807까지입니다.

리터럴

[ + | - ] digit [ ... ] [L]

digit: 0에서 9 사이의 숫자입니다.

리터럴 후위가 L(또는 l)이 아니고 INT 범위 내에 있는 경우 암시적으로 INT로 변환됩니다.

예제

> SELECT +1L;
  1

> SELECT CAST('5' AS BIGINT);
  5

> SELECT typeof(-2147483);
  INT

> SELECT typeof(123456789012345);
  BIGINT